I want to get line number of code which cause error. For example;

static void Main(string[] args)
{
    using (SqlConnection conn = new SqlConnection(bagcum))
    {
        SqlCommand cmd = conn.CreateCommand();
        cmd.CommandText = "DONTINSERT into GIVEMEERROR(CamNo,Statu) values (" + 23 + "," + 0 + ")";
        conn.Open();
        int n = c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
    }
}

so As we know that code doesn't work, it will throw exception Line number of code which is:

int n = c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();

So how can get that line number of using try-catch? I tried using a StackTrace class but it gives line number as 0:

static void Main(string[] args)
{
    try
    {
        using (SqlConnection conn = new SqlConnection(bagcum))
        {
            SqlCommand cmd = conn.CreateCommand();
            cmd.CommandText = "DONTINSERT into GIVEMEERROR(CamNo,Statu) values (" + 23 + "," + 0 + ")";
            conn.Open();
            int n = c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
        }        
    }
    catch (Exception ex)
    {
        System.Diagnostics.StackTrace trace = new System.Diagnostics.StackTrace(ex, true);            
        Console.WriteLine("Line: " + trace.GetFrame(0).GetFileLineNumber());
    }
}

OUTPUT:

Line:0

Update:
Usually error line of code is 22 so I have to get that number.

Try this simple hack instead:

First Add this (extension) class to your namespace(most be toplevel class):

public static class ExceptionHelper
{
    public static int LineNumber(this Exception e)
    {

        int linenum = 0;
        try
        {
            //linenum = Convert.ToInt32(e.StackTrace.Substring(e.StackTrace.LastIndexOf(":line") + 5));

            //For Localized Visual Studio ... In other languages stack trace  doesn't end with ":Line 12"
            linenum = Convert.ToInt32(e.StackTrace.Substring(e.StackTrace.LastIndexOf(' ')));

        }


        catch
        {
            //Stack trace is not available!
        }
        return linenum;
    }
}

And its done!Use LineNumber method whenever you need it:

try
{
//Do your code here
}
catch (Exception e)
{
int linenum = e.LineNumber();
}
